What is PVC-U pipe?

PVC-U pipe stands for unplasticized polyvinyl chloride pipe, a rigid and durable plastic piping material used widely in plumbing and drainage. It is designed for long-term performance in cold water supply, drainage, and waste systems, as well as irrigation and conduit applications. PVC-U pipes are known for their smooth internal surface, chemical resistance, and low friction, which helps maintain steady flow. They are typically white or light grey and come in metric (mm) and imperial (inch) sizing to fit a wide range of fittings and installations.
  • Rigid, corrosion-resistant piping for domestic, commercial, and industrial uses
  • Commonly used for cold-water supply, drainage, soil and vent systems, and irrigation piping
  • Join with solvent weld fittings, push-fit fittings, or compression fittings
  • Available in multiple sizes from small diameter 20 mm (3/4 inch) up to large diameter 110 mm (4 inch) and beyond for drainage

What are the main uses of pvc u pipe in plumbing and drainage?

PVC-U pipe is a versatile option for many plumbing and drainage tasks. It is ideal for cold water distribution, rainwater downpipes, sewerage drainage, waste piping, and venting systems. It is also commonly used for irrigation lines, greywater systems, and certain industrial piping where chemical compatibility is required. For domestic installations, PVC-U pipe provides reliable performance in below-ground drainage and above-ground drainage networks, as well as in clean water supply lines in many regions.
  • Cold water distribution and potable water supply (non‑hot systems)
  • Drainage and waste piping (soil and vent systems)
  • Irrigation and landscape piping
  • Conduit-like uses in some low-load electrical or cabling installations where permitted
  • Chemical-compatible piping in non-hot service environments

What sizes and types of pvc u pipe are typically available?

PVC-U pipe is produced in a range of diameters and wall thicknesses to suit different pressures and flows. You’ll commonly find metric sizes from 20 mm to 110 mm, plus imperial equivalents. Types include:
  • Pressure-rated PVC-U pipe for cold-water supply and other pressurized services
  • Drainage and DWV PVC-U pipe for waste, soil, and vent systems
  • Different wall thicknesses and schedules to match PN/pressure ratings
  • Flexible and rigid fittings, including solvent-weld, push-fit, and compression options
When selecting, check the diameter (nominal bore) and the intended application (water supply vs drainage) to ensure compatibility with the fittings and the installation environment.

Can PVC-U pipe be used for hot water or high-temperature service?

PVC-U is primarily designed for cold water and non‑hot service. Prolonged exposure to high temperatures can reduce strength and cause deformation or failure. For hot water or higher-temperature applications, CPVC or other materials such as PEX or copper are typically recommended. If your project involves heated fluids, select CPVC or a temperature-rated alternative and verify compatibility with local codes and the specific fluid being transported.
  • Use PVC-U for cold water distribution and drainage
  • Reserve CPVC or other high-temperature plastics for hot-water circuits
  • Always consult manufacturer specifications and local plumbing codes

How do I join PVC-U pipe to fittings?

Joining PVC-U pipe is straightforward, using one of several common methods:
  • Solvent-weld joints with appropriate primer and solvent cement for a strong, permanent seal
  • Push-fit fittings for quick assemblies with a gasketed connection
  • Compression fittings where permitted, often used in non-permanent or retrofit applications
Steps for solvent weld:
  • Cut the pipe square and deburr the edge
  • Dry-fit to check alignment
  • Clean and prime the pipe and fitting
  • Apply solvent cement to both surfaces and assemble with a twist to ensure full coverage
  • Hold firmly until the joint sets

What fittings and accessories work best with pvc u pipe?

PVC-U systems use a broad range of compatible fittings and accessories. Look for certified PVC-U solvent-weld fittings (tees, elbows, couplers, adaptors), push-fit quick-connects, end caps, traps, and unions. Accessories include primer, solvent cement, pipe cutters, deburring tools, and pipe supports. For drainage, ensure you choose correctly sized soil and waste fittings, adaptors for transitioning to other materials, and appropriate spacers or clips to maintain alignment.
  • Solvent-weld fittings (tees, elbows, couplers)
  • Push-fit and compression fittings for retrofit or non-permanent installations
  • End caps, traps, and adaptors for transitions
  • Primer and cement, cutting tools, deburring tools, and pipe supports

What are common installation tips and best practices for pvc u pipe?

Practical guidance helps ensure reliable performance and longevity:
  • Measure accurately, cut square, and deburr edges for clean joints
  • Use compatible primer and solvent cement for solvent-welded connections
  • Support pipes properly to prevent sagging and misalignment
  • Avoid exposing PVC-U to prolonged direct sunlight on unprotected exterior runs, unless rated for outdoor use
  • Vent drainage systems where required by code to prevent siphoning and odors
  • Check local codes for allowable uses, installation methods, and required fittings

How long does pvc u pipe typically last and how should I maintain it?

When correctly installed, PVC-U pipe can offer decades of service, often 50 years or more, depending on exposure, pressure, and chemical environment. Maintenance involves periodic inspection of joints and supports, ensuring there are no cracks or signs of degradation, and replacing any worn or compromised fittings promptly. PVC-U’s chemical resistance helps resist many household chemicals and minerals, contributing to a low-maintenance profile for drainage and cold-water systems.
  • Regularly inspect joints and supports for movement or leakage
  • Replace damaged fittings or cracked pipe segments promptly
  • Keep solvent-weld joints clean and dry during installation
  • Avoid exposing exterior PVC-U piping to unprotected UV light unless rated for outdoor use
